Picnic Basket and Flags Coloring Page: History & Fun Facts

Picnics Fit the Summer Holiday

Independence Day falls in midsummer, which is one reason food, blankets, cool drinks, and outdoor gatherings became part of the holiday's everyday look. A picnic basket scene points to the family side of July Fourth rather than the formal civic side. It shows how a national holiday can also become a day for parks, backyards, neighborhood lawns, and shared meals.

Small Flags Turn the Basket Into a Holiday Object

A basket by itself could belong to any warm-weather outing. Small flags change the meaning immediately. They connect the food and blanket to a specific celebration and make the scene read as July Fourth without needing a parade or fireworks display. This is how many real decorations work: one familiar object becomes seasonal when a symbol is added.

Outdoor Meals Have Long Been Part of Public Celebration

Community meals, civic dinners, and outdoor gatherings have appeared in Independence Day celebrations for generations. Early celebrations often included speeches and organized public meals, while later family traditions added cookouts, picnics, and neighborhood parties. A picnic basket therefore fits both the historical habit of gathering and the modern habit of celebrating outside.
